Hearty classic chili the whole family will love.
Cut stew meat into bite-sized pieces. Sear well on all sides. Cover with water and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er 1 hour until tender; drain.
In a large dutch oven or stock pot, sweat onion until translucent. Add garlic. Add remaining ingredients and simmer for 30 minutes to 1 hour, even longer is better.
Serve with sliced cheddar cheese, fresh flour tortillas, and corn bread. Even better the next day!
Trust me on the spice quantities - it seems like a lot, but it tastes wonderful.
